A pair of guitars the late Eddie Van Halen designed and played onstage are heading to the auction block as part of Icons & Idols Trilogy: Rock ‘N’ Roll, one in a series of high-dollar auctions set to commence next week in Beverly Hills for Julien’s Auctions.

‘Eddie Van Halen thrilled audiences with his virtuosic and electrifying guitar playing on his stripe designed electric guitars in his high energy performances while flying through the air,’ a description on the auction site read. 

It continued: ‘At center stage of this auction will be two of these important guitars custom designed and played by the lead guitarist and co-founder of the American rock band Van Halen.’

The musical instruments coming from the collection of the late Van Halen – which include a 2004 EVH Charvel Art Series guitar – are projected to bring in between $60,000 and $80,000 apiece.

The company’s president Darren Julien said that plans were in the offing for the guitars to hit the auction block prior to his death October 6 at the age of 65 after battling cancer.

‘As we were preparing for our annual Icons & Idols: Rock and Roll auction lineup, we were stunned to hear the sad news of Eddie Van Halen’s passing last week,’ Julien said in October in a statement. ‘We are honored to include at this event two of his iconic guitars from his brilliant and blazing career as one of rock’s greatest and most gifted guitar heroes.’

Other auction wares come from the estate of Michael Jackson, who collaborated with Van Halen on his 1982 hit Beat It.

One of the late King of Pop’s studded white gloves he wore while touring with his brothers is up for sale, as well as a pair of loafers he wore on tour.

Another guitar up for sale is a Fender Stratocaster Cobain late Nirvana frontman Kurt Cobain played and destroyed onstage during the grunge band’s In Utero tour in 1994.

The musical auction features other souvenirs linked to famed entertainers such as Bob Marley, Jimi Hendrix, Elvis Presley, among others. The company also has auction collections with sports and movie memorabilia coming up. 

The auction is slated to be held both in person and online December 1 and 2.
